Draftboard

Draftboard is a New York-based B2B platform that enables companies to publicly list open positions with referral bonuses payable to anyone ('Scouts') who successfully refers a hired candidate, taking a 20% cut per placement. The platform integrates with ATS tools (Greenhouse, Lever, Workable) and has recently pivoted messaging toward warm-introduction network intelligence for B2B sales prospecting.

Beam is a serverless GPU cloud platform purpose-built for AI workloads, enabling developers to deploy ML inference endpoints, background jobs, and sandboxed code execution via Python/TypeScript decorators with sub-200ms cold starts and instant autoscaling. Founded in 2021 and YC-backed, Beam serves hundreds of companies from early-stage startups to Fortune 100 enterprises handling millions of requests per day.
